New Link and Referral Units support local emergency departments
Island Health and BC Emergency Health Services have created a new pathway for patients who don’t require emergency care but still need medical attention. The new Link and Referral Units (LARUs) consist of single paramedics in minivans, specializing in assessing and treating 911 patients with non-urgent conditions. Read more here.
